About Inflatable Leeds
Saturday 20th June 2026
📍 Harewood House, Harewood, Leeds. LS17 9LG
Get ready to bounce your way through The World’s BIGGEST and most EPIC Inflatable Obstacle Course!
The Inflatable 5k Obstacle Course is coming to Leeds on Saturday 20th June 2026 and it’s going to be Epic! The obstacles are BIGGER, BOUNCIER and BETTER than ever before! You’ll be jumping, sliding and laughing all the way to the finish line. Grab your friends, family or tackle it on your own. Lace up your trainers and get ready for the ultimate day out!
Children between 5 – 15 years old must be accompanied by a paying participating adult (3:1 child:adult ratio) Unfortunately, if this is not met, you will not be able to participate at the event.
Inflatable Leeds 2.5K: £25
Inflatable Leeds 5K: £30
Inflatable Leeds 10K: £40
Inflatable Leeds 15K: £45
Places are offered in partnership with Run for Charity, follow the link below to secure your place today. For more info on this event, email events@chsf.org.uk
